Explore the intricate world of wine with American Wine Economics by James Thornton. Published in 2013 by the University of California Press, this comprehensive hardback spans 368 pages, making it an essential read for students of economics, wine professionals, and enthusiasts alike.
This insightful book offers a unified and systematic understanding of the economic organization of the wine trade. Delve into the complex attributes of the industry, including grape growing, wine production, and distribution activities.
